"depictures" vs "figure depictures"

The correct phrase is "depicts." Both "depicts" and "figure depictures" are not commonly used in English. The correct form is "depicts" when describing an image or scene.

Last Updated: March 15, 2024

depictures

This is not a commonly used term in English. The correct form is "depicts."

The term "depicts" is used to describe an image or scene in a written or spoken context.

Alternatives:

  • depicts
  • illustrates
  • shows
  • portrays
  • represents
